div.reactions {
	margin: 5px 0 0 0;
}
	div.reactions div.reactionlist {
	}	
		div.reactionlist h1.fheader {
			padding: 0 5px 5px 5px;
			width: auto;
			margin: 0;
		}
		
	div.reactionlist div.reactionpost {
		clear: both;
	}
		div.reactionpost div.posttop {
			background-color: #E2D6CA;
			margin-bottom: 5px;
			margin-top: 5px;
			padding: 3px 5px;
		}
			div.reactionpost span.btns {
				display: block;
				float: right;
				margin-right: 1px;
			}
			div.reactionpost span.icons {
			}
				div.reactionpost span.icons span.empty {
					display: none;
				}
				div.reactionpost span.icons span.unread,
				div.reactionpost span.icons span.read {
					background-repeat: no-repeat;
					width: 14px;
					height: 12px;
					display: block;
					float: left;
					margin: 3px 5px 0px 0px;
				}
				div.reactionpost span.icons span.unread {
					background-image: url('/graphics/envelope.unread.gif');
				}
				div.reactionpost span.icons span.read {
					background-image: url('/graphics/envelope.read.gif');
				}
			div.reactionpost span.name {
			}
			div.reactionpost span.date {
			}
			div.reactionpost div.reactiontext {
				padding: 9px 23px 9px 23px;
				font-size: 1.0em;
			}

form.reactionform {
	/* display: none; */
	padding: 0;
}
/**
 * For edit window
*/
div.reactionedit {
	margin: 20px auto;
	width: 405px;
}
	div.reactionedit div.small div.block div.top,
	div.reactionedit div.small div.block div.midd,
	div.reactionedit div.small div.block div.btm {
		background-position: 5px 0;
	}
		div.reactionedit div.small div.content {
			padding: 20px 25px 20px 35px;
		}
	
	form.reactionedit {
		padding: 0;
		margin: 0;
		width: 345px;
	} 
		form.reactionedit  table.formtable {
			margin-top: 20px;
			font-size: 11px;
		}
			form.reactionedit table.formtable td {
				padding: 4px;
				text-align: left;
			}
		form.reactionedit .hidesmilies {
			display: none;
		}